Most creditors or vendors, offer very Assertiveness This is an indicator of an individual’s ability to communicate. This will closely relate to leadership ability and is important for any position that requires giving direction to others. Here are a couple of questions to gain a better understanding of a candidate’s strength in this area. Tell me about a time when you had to speak up in order to get your point across. Be specific. Tell me about a time when you had to “sell” your manager or co-workers on one of your ideas. What was the idea and what was the outcome? Energy Level This is an indicator of an individual’s ability to maintain intense levels of work for long periods of time. While most candidates will be able to complete an 8 hour work day, someone with a low energy level will feel the effects much more than someone with a high energy level. This is also an indicator of an individual’s propensity to work quickly. Here are a couple of questions to determine the strength of a candidate in this area. Tell me about a time when you were required to work with a team on an important project and you weren’t pleased with the speed at which it progressed. How did you deal with the situation? Describe a situation where you were required to work an extended period of time to accomplish a task. What was the situation and how did you keep yourself motivated? These interview questions should set you on the right path to becoming a proficient behavioral interviewer.
